160535360327 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 160535360328. Its totient is φ = 160535360326.
The previous prime is 160535360311. The next prime is 160535360333. The reversal of 160535360327 is 723063535061.
It is a happy number.
It is a strong prime.
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 160535360327 - 24 = 160535360311 is a prime.
It is a congruent number.
It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(160535360387)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 80267680163 + 80267680164.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(80267680164).
Almost surely, 2160535360327 is an apocalyptic number.
160535360327 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).
160535360327 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
160535360327 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 340200, while the sum is 41.
Adding to 160535360327 its reverse (723063535061), we get a palindrome (883598895388).
The spelling of 160535360327 in words is "one hundred sixty billion, five hundred thirty-five million, three hundred sixty thousand, three hundred twenty-seven".
